Michigan is grouped geographically into ten prosperity regions. Prosperity regions were created in 2013 to encourage local private, public, and non-profit partners from each region to develop a local economic vision. Additionally, state agencies have organized their services around these new geographic boundaries to create a better structure for collaboration.
